 | /** | 
 |  * qcom_register_dump_segments() - register segments for coredump | 
 |  * @rproc:	remoteproc handle | 
 |  * @fw:		firmware header | 
 |  * | 
 |  * Register all segments of the ELF in the remoteproc coredump segment list | 
 |  * | 
 |  * Return: 0 on success, negative errno on failure. | 
 |  */ | 
 | int qcom_register_dump_segments(struct rproc *rproc, | 
 | 				const struct firmware *fw) | 
 | { | 
 | 	const struct elf32_phdr *phdrs; | 
 | 	const struct elf32_phdr *phdr; | 
 | 	const struct elf32_hdr *ehdr; | 
 | 	int ret; | 
 | 	int i; | 
 |  | 
 | 	ehdr = (struct elf32_hdr *)fw->data; | 
 | 	phdrs = (struct elf32_phdr *)(ehdr + 1); | 
 |  | 
 | 	for (i = 0; i < ehdr->e_phnum; i++) { | 
 | 		phdr = &phdrs[i]; | 
 |  | 
 | 		if (phdr->p_type != PT_LOAD) | 
 | 			continue; | 
 |  | 
 | 		if ((phdr->p_flags & QCOM_MDT_TYPE_MASK) == QCOM_MDT_TYPE_HASH) | 
 | 			continue; | 
 |  | 
 | 		if (!phdr->p_memsz) | 
 | 			continue; | 
 |  | 
 | 		ret = rproc_coredump_add_segment(rproc, phdr->p_paddr, | 
 | 						 phdr->p_memsz); | 
 | 		if (ret) | 
 | 			return ret; | 
 | 	} | 
 |  | 
 | 	return 0; | 
 | } | 
 | EXPORT_SYMBOL_GPL(qcom_register_dump_segments); |

 | static struct qcom_ssr_subsystem *qcom_ssr_get_subsys(const char *name) | 
 | { | 
 | 	struct qcom_ssr_subsystem *info; | 
 |  | 
 | 	mutex_lock(&qcom_ssr_subsys_lock); | 
 | 	/* Match in the global qcom_ssr_subsystem_list with name */ | 
 | 	list_for_each_entry(info, &qcom_ssr_subsystem_list, list) | 
 | 		if (!strcmp(info->name, name)) | 
 | 			goto out; | 
 |  | 
 | 	info = kzalloc(sizeof(*info), GFP_KERNEL); | 
 | 	if (!info) { | 
 | 		info = ERR_PTR(-ENOMEM); | 
 | 		goto out; | 
 | 	} | 
 | 	info->name = kstrdup_const(name, GFP_KERNEL); | 
 | 	srcu_init_notifier_head(&info->notifier_list); | 
 |  | 
 | 	/* Add to global notification list */ | 
 | 	list_add_tail(&info->list, &qcom_ssr_subsystem_list); | 
 |  | 
 | out: | 
 | 	mutex_unlock(&qcom_ssr_subsys_lock); | 
 | 	return info; | 
 | } | 
 |  | 
 | /** | 
 |  * qcom_register_ssr_notifier() - register SSR notification handler | 
 |  * @name:	Subsystem's SSR name | 
 |  * @nb:		notifier_block to be invoked upon subsystem's state change | 
 |  * | 
 |  * This registers the @nb notifier block as part the notifier chain for a | 
 |  * remoteproc associated with @name. The notifier block's callback | 
 |  * will be invoked when the remote processor's SSR events occur | 
 |  * (pre/post startup and pre/post shutdown). | 
 |  * | 
 |  * Return: a subsystem cookie on success, ERR_PTR on failure. | 
 |  */ | 
 | void *qcom_register_ssr_notifier(const char *name, struct notifier_block *nb) | 
 | { | 
 | 	struct qcom_ssr_subsystem *info; | 
 |  | 
 | 	info = qcom_ssr_get_subsys(name); | 
 | 	if (IS_ERR(info)) | 
 | 		return info; | 
 |  | 
 | 	srcu_notifier_chain_register(&info->notifier_list, nb); | 
 |  | 
 | 	return &info->notifier_list; | 
 | } | 
 | EXPORT_SYMBOL_GPL(qcom_register_ssr_notifier); | 
 |  | 
 | /** | 
 |  * qcom_unregister_ssr_notifier() - unregister SSR notification handler | 
 |  * @notify:	subsystem cookie returned from qcom_register_ssr_notifier | 
 |  * @nb:		notifier_block to unregister | 
 |  * | 
 |  * This function will unregister the notifier from the particular notifier | 
 |  * chain. | 
 |  * | 
 |  * Return: 0 on success, %ENOENT otherwise. | 
 |  */ | 
 | int qcom_unregister_ssr_notifier(void *notify, struct notifier_block *nb) | 
 | { | 
 | 	return srcu_notifier_chain_unregister(notify, nb); | 
 | } | 
 | EXPORT_SYMBOL_GPL(qcom_unregister_ssr_notifier); |

 | static int ssr_notify_prepare(struct rproc_subdev *subdev) | 
 | { | 
 | 	struct qcom_rproc_ssr *ssr = to_ssr_subdev(subdev); | 
 | 	struct qcom_ssr_notify_data data = { | 
 | 		.name = ssr->info->name, | 
 | 		.crashed = false, | 
 | 	}; | 
 |  | 
 | 	srcu_notifier_call_chain(&ssr->info->notifier_list, | 
 | 				 QCOM_SSR_BEFORE_POWERUP, &data); | 
 | 	return 0; | 
 | } | 
 |  | 
 | static int ssr_notify_start(struct rproc_subdev *subdev) | 
 | { | 
 | 	struct qcom_rproc_ssr *ssr = to_ssr_subdev(subdev); | 
 | 	struct qcom_ssr_notify_data data = { | 
 | 		.name = ssr->info->name, | 
 | 		.crashed = false, | 
 | 	}; | 
 |  | 
 | 	srcu_notifier_call_chain(&ssr->info->notifier_list, | 
 | 				 QCOM_SSR_AFTER_POWERUP, &data); | 
 | 	return 0; | 
 | } | 
 |  | 
 | static void ssr_notify_stop(struct rproc_subdev *subdev, bool crashed) | 
 | { | 
 | 	struct qcom_rproc_ssr *ssr = to_ssr_subdev(subdev); | 
 | 	struct qcom_ssr_notify_data data = { | 
 | 		.name = ssr->info->name, | 
 | 		.crashed = crashed, | 
 | 	}; | 
 |  | 
 | 	srcu_notifier_call_chain(&ssr->info->notifier_list, | 
 | 				 QCOM_SSR_BEFORE_SHUTDOWN, &data); | 
 | } | 
 |  | 
 | static void ssr_notify_unprepare(struct rproc_subdev *subdev) | 
 | { | 
 | 	struct qcom_rproc_ssr *ssr = to_ssr_subdev(subdev); | 
 | 	struct qcom_ssr_notify_data data = { | 
 | 		.name = ssr->info->name, | 
 | 		.crashed = false, | 
 | 	}; | 
 |  | 
 | 	srcu_notifier_call_chain(&ssr->info->notifier_list, | 
 | 				 QCOM_SSR_AFTER_SHUTDOWN, &data); | 
 | } | 
 |  | 
 | /** | 
 |  * qcom_add_ssr_subdev() - register subdevice as restart notification source | 
 |  * @rproc:	rproc handle | 
 |  * @ssr:	SSR subdevice handle | 
 |  * @ssr_name:	identifier to use for notifications originating from @rproc | 
 |  * | 
 |  * As the @ssr is registered with the @rproc SSR events will be sent to all | 
 |  * registered listeners for the remoteproc when it's SSR events occur | 
 |  * (pre/post startup and pre/post shutdown). | 
 |  */ | 
 | void qcom_add_ssr_subdev(struct rproc *rproc, struct qcom_rproc_ssr *ssr, | 
 | 			 const char *ssr_name) | 
 | { | 
 | 	struct qcom_ssr_subsystem *info; | 
 |  | 
 | 	info = qcom_ssr_get_subsys(ssr_name); | 
 | 	if (IS_ERR(info)) { | 
 | 		dev_err(&rproc->dev, "Failed to add ssr subdevice\n"); | 
 | 		return; | 
 | 	} | 
 |  | 
 | 	ssr->info = info; | 
 | 	ssr->subdev.prepare = ssr_notify_prepare; | 
 | 	ssr->subdev.start = ssr_notify_start; | 
 | 	ssr->subdev.stop = ssr_notify_stop; | 
 | 	ssr->subdev.unprepare = ssr_notify_unprepare; | 
 |  | 
 | 	rproc_add_subdev(rproc, &ssr->subdev); | 
 | } | 
 | EXPORT_SYMBOL_GPL(qcom_add_ssr_subdev); | 
 |  | 
 | /** | 
 |  * qcom_remove_ssr_subdev() - remove subdevice as restart notification source | 
 |  * @rproc:	rproc handle | 
 |  * @ssr:	SSR subdevice handle | 
 |  */ | 
 | void qcom_remove_ssr_subdev(struct rproc *rproc, struct qcom_rproc_ssr *ssr) | 
 | { | 
 | 	rproc_remove_subdev(rproc, &ssr->subdev); | 
 | 	ssr->info = NULL; | 
 | } | 
 | EXPORT_SYMBOL_GPL(qcom_remove_ssr_subdev); |
